Only problem is they have a good receiving corp and no one to throw them the ball. Their production will suffer big time because of it.
2011 Stats: 3100 yards 17TD's 5INT's and a rating over 90...with no receivers! Alex Smith isn't the problem. He's had a different coordinator every year. This will be his second year under the same system, I look for him to be even better. Now with Moss and Manningham able to spread the field and Davis working over the middle, 49ers fans should be very happy about the possibilities. Smith threw 5TD's and no INT's during the post season as well. The guy doesn't turn the ball over under this system. He just needs guys to catch the ball and get open.
